#8f57d1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8f57d1 is composed of 56.1% red, 34.1%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.6% cyan, 58.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 267.5 degrees, a saturation of 57% and a lightness of 58%. #8f57d1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aeff with #1f00a3.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

● #8f57d1 color description : Moderate violet.
#8f57d1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8f57d1 has RGB values of R:143, G:87, B:209 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 9394129.

Shades and Tints of #8f57d1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f6f1f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#8f57d1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#949197 is the less saturated color, while #8c2efa is the most saturated one.
